What to Expect From Cocaine Detox

  The consequences of detox from cocain can range from moderate to severe, depending on the amount consumed and the period of consumption. Because cocaine is such a potent and fast-acting stimulant, withdrawal symptoms can cause a variety of physiological and mental health negative effects.


A cocaine high occurs rapidly and diminishes within a few minutes to an hour, according to a 2016 review released by the National Institute on Drug Abuse. When the high wears off, you're left wanting more, which is why the withdrawal and detox processes are fraught with psychiatric symptoms. Comedowns, anxiety, and depression are examples of these.


"There is a significant difference in how someone becomes addicted to cocaine, and it really relies on the route of administration and potency of the drug," Gerald Opthof, PsyD, LPC, CSW, director of Opthof Center for Psychotherapy, tells WebMD Connect to Care. "Someone who smokes crack cocaine feels the affects considerably sooner than someone who injects it, and they may end up needing more to maintain the high," Opthof explains.


Cocaine withdrawal symptoms can begin 90 minutes after the last use of the substance and extend up to 10 days or longer, according to American Addiction Centers. The length of time and amount of cocaine consumed can have an impact on the detox phase.


According to American Addiction Centers, cocaine withdrawal symptoms are not as physically acute as other drug withdrawal symptoms. 

Cocaine detox causes psychological withdrawal symptoms such as:

  • Concentration problems
  • Slowing action or thinking
  • Hostility
  • Depression
  • Anxiety
  • Nightmares or vivid dreams
  • Paranoia
  • Suicidal ideas or actions
  • Increased desire for cocaine


Cocaine detox is typically performed as an outpatient procedure to alleviate withdrawal symptoms, although in some cases, an inpatient treatment programme may be necessary. "Those with health, family, or career concerns might be best served in an inpatient setting," Opthof says.
